Pic-Time gives you the ability to schedule the date and time that emails are sent. You can schedule certain emails to send at a specific date and time, based on your own timezone settings.
Please Note: Emails can only be scheduled from within a specific gallery or Automation. They cannot be scheduled from a Gallery Template or Email Package.
What emails can be scheduled?
Emails that can be scheduled include:
Gallery is Ready email to Main Client
Gallery invite via email to Photographer Invited users
Automation emails
Scheduling the Gallery is Ready Email
1. To schedule the Gallery is Ready email for your Main Client (the email inviting your Main Client to their gallery), first go to the specific gallery and make sure:
The gallery does not have any unwanted Automations assigned in the Shop tab.
When setting the gallery Online, some Automations will automatically begin and send its email to the client, so double-check your Automation's settings first and Edit the Automation Start if needed, or Unassign from gallery.
The gallery is set to be Online.
When scheduling the Main Client invite email, the email will only send at the scheduled time if the gallery is already Online. The email will not send at the scheduled time if the gallery is Offline, so you will need to manually turn the gallery Online. It is not possible to schedule the gallery to go Online, but the client will not be able to access the gallery until they have the link.
2. Then go to the gallery’s Share tab, and enter your Main Client’s name and email address. Click Send to Client.
3. Edit the email Message, and click Schedule Email. Learn more about Email Packages here.
4. Choose from the suggested times or choose your own date and time.
5. Then click Schedule Email to save the changes and schedule the email. Your email will be sent at the scheduled time.
Can I edit scheduled emails?
A scheduled email cannot be edited. Instead, it will need to be canceled and rescheduled.
How do I cancel or view scheduled emails?
Click here to go to your Client Galleries > User Activity and locate the specific gallery. In the All Users section, locate the scheduled email in the Activity Type column.
In the rightmost column, click View Email to view the email, or Cancel Email to cancel the scheduled send.
Sales Automation Emails
The above email scheduling feature refers to standard system emails. If you have created a Sales Automation, emails can also be sent through the Automation. There are two factors to determine the email send time in an Automation, which we will go over below. For more information about setting up emails in specific Automations, search the Sales Automation Section of our Help Center for the specific one.
Automation Email Send Time
Within most Automations, you can schedule the email send time, either at an Optimized Schedule, or at the Earliest possible time. If you select the Earliest possible time, the email schedule is based on the Automation Assignment Setup (see below).
Automation Assignment Start
When you assign an Automation to a gallery, you may have the option to schedule when the Automation begins. Depending on the Automation, this will also be the time emails are sent out. You can set the exact date and time for the Automation to begin.
For example, if you are using the General Coupon Automation and have emails set to send at the Earliest possible time, then the emails will send according to your Automation Start.
However, for Automations like the Abandoned Cart Automation, emails will be sent according to when the customer left the items in their shopping cart.
